pharma devices can encompass a wide range of products, from drug delivery systems to wearable devices that monitor patient health in real-time. These devices are designed to deliver medications more efficiently and accurately, ensuring that patients receive the right dosage at the right time. This can lead to better treatment outcomes and improved patient adherence, as well as reduce the risk of medication errors.
One of the key advantages of pharma devices is their ability to provide personalized medicine. By incorporating sensors and monitoring technology, these devices can track a patient’s individual response to treatment and adjust dosages accordingly. This level of customization can lead to more targeted and effective therapies, ultimately improving patient outcomes.
Another benefit of pharma devices is their potential to improve patient engagement and adherence to treatment plans. By incorporating features such as reminders and tracking capabilities, these devices can help patients stay on track with their medications and monitor their progress more easily. This can be particularly beneficial for patients with chronic conditions who require long-term medication regimens.
The development of pharma devices has also opened up new opportunities for remote monitoring and telemedicine. These devices can transmit real-time data to healthcare providers, allowing for remote monitoring of patient health and early detection of potential issues. This can help to reduce the need for in-person visits and hospitalizations, particularly for patients in rural or underserved areas.
In addition to improving patient outcomes and access to care, pharma devices also have the potential to drive cost savings for healthcare systems. By reducing medication errors, improving adherence, and enabling remote monitoring, these devices can help to prevent costly complications and hospitalizations. This can lead to significant savings for both patients and healthcare providers in the long run.
As the healthcare industry continues to evolve and embrace digital technologies, the market for pharma devices is expected to grow rapidly. In fact, the global market for connected drug delivery devices is projected to reach $836 million by 2026, driven by increasing demand for personalized medicine and remote monitoring solutions. This growth is fueled by advancements in technologies such as Internet of Things (IoT), artificial intelligence, and data analytics, which are being incorporated into pharma devices to enhance their capabilities.
Despite the many benefits of pharma devices, there are still challenges that need to be addressed. One of the key challenges is ensuring the security and privacy of patient data transmitted by these devices. With the increasing connectivity of healthcare devices, there is a growing concern about the risk of data breaches and cyber attacks. It is essential for manufacturers and healthcare providers to implement robust security measures to protect patient information and comply with data privacy regulations.
Another challenge is ensuring the interoperability of pharma devices with existing healthcare systems and electronic health records. In order for these devices to deliver their full potential, they need to be able to seamlessly integrate with other systems and share data effectively. This requires collaboration and standardization across stakeholders in the healthcare industry, including device manufacturers, regulators, and healthcare providers.
